Avià is a municipality in the comarca of Berguedà, in Catalonia. Its population in 2007 was 2108 inhabitants.
The municipality is made up of three towns: Avià, Graugés and La Plana. Its economical activity is based on agriculture and textile industry. In 2010 the population of the town was 2223.
The mayor is Patrocini Canal Burniol.[4]
Landmarks
- Church of Sant Vicenç d'Obiols. Pre-Romanesque
- Church of Santa Maria d'Avià. Romanesque
- Serrat dels Lladres (Avià).
- Serradet del Bullidor.
- Sant Martí d'Avià, the parish church in Plaça del Ateneu, also known as Plaça del Secretari.
